Colwyn Bay station is well-equipped to cater to the needs of every traveler. Whether you're catching an early train or returning late, the station's ticket office ensures you can purchase or collect tickets with ease during its operational hours: from 06:15 to 19:20 on weekdays and 09:10 to 16:40 on Sundays. Ticket machines that are accessible and user-friendly compliment the in-person services offered, and they're conveniently located next to the booking office. Accepted payment methods include cash and cards, ensuring flexibility for all passengers.
Accessibility is a key feature, with step-free access throughout the station, complemented by lifts connecting both platforms. The helpful staff are available for assistance, and you can even request travel assistance up to 2 hours prior to your journey start. This makes the station accommodating for individuals with varying needs, ensuring everyone can travel with confidence.
Beyond the confines of the station, you'll find a plethora of transport options to continue your journey seamlessly. The rail replacement bus service conveniently operates from the station car park, stepping in during service disruptions. For those preferring road travel, taxis are readily available at the front of the station.
Public transport enthusiasts can benefit from a Colwyn Bay PlusBus ticket, which offers unlimited bus travel around the town at a discounted rate when purchased with a train ticket. This makes exploring the local area both economical and simple.

Skipton station operates with convenience at the forefront. The ticket office is open from Monday to Saturday, 5:50 am to 6:20 pm, and on Sundays from 9:00 am to 4:30 pm. For those pursuing a contactless and hassle-free experience, there are ticket machines that accept both cash and card payments, ready to dispense pre-purchased tickets as well.
Accessibility is well catered for at Skipton station. It boasts step-free access throughout, ensuring ease of movement for all passengers, regardless of mobility. However, it's noteworthy that while accessible toilets are not available, standard toilet facilities can be used during ticket office hours.
Though the waiting rooms are absent, seating areas provide comfort while you await your train. Additionally, for anyone needing a helping hand, assistance can be requested through the Passenger Assist service, offering peace of mind for those who require a bit more support during their travels.
Skipton train station is a hub of connectivity. Right outside the station, you'll find a taxi rank, ready to take you onward. For those looking to explore further via bus, the Busline at 0871 200 2233 provides comprehensive route options. And during times when rail services are disrupted, a replacement bus service operates conveniently from the station car park.
While there's no bicycle hire directly at the station, ample cycle storage is available between platforms one and two for those preferring to pedal their way around town.
